YouView Humax DTR-T1010 set-top box released with silver finish

Humax has launched the latest in its YouView set-top box range, the YouView Humax DTR-T1010, complete with brand new silver finish.  

The successor of the critically acclaimed YouView Humax DTR-T1000, the new Humax YouView box offers all the features of the older model but now comes in both 500GB and 1TB internal storage options.

Unfortunately, like the Humax DTR-T1000, the new YouView Humax DTR-T1010 still lacks inbuilt Wi-Fi connectivity, instead using an Ethernet port to connect to home broadband networks. The new colour scheme hides the fact that the YouView Humax DTR-T1010 is, specs-wise, a mirror of its predecessor, which will now be phased out of stores by the new silver-skinned model.

YouView is a subscription-free TV service that offers over 70 live digital channels as well as providing access to BBC iPlayer, ITV Player, 4oD and Demand 5 via an internet connection. On-demand services also include the STV player and milkshake! content, alongside Sky Now TV offering pay-per-view blockbuster movies.  

The YouView TV guide allows users to scroll back through the past seven days and catch up with any shows they might have missed. The ability to pause and rewind live TV is also offered, just in case viewers have to take a break or missed a pivotal plot moment for any reason. The huge internal storage options of the Humax DTR-T1010 means users can use YouView’s recording capabilities to save tonnes of programmes to watch at a later date. With YouView, users can record up to two programmes at once, even whilst watching a third.

Available now from John Lewis, the YouView Humax DTR-T1010 will cost £299.99 for the 500GB model and just £30 more for double the storage capacity at £329.99 for 1TB. The Humax YouView set-top box will be coming to other electronics retailers later this month.
